Paul W. Schenk, Psy.D. 

A clinical psychologist in private practice in Atlanta's Northlake area since 1979, my services include:
  • psychotherapy for adults, teens, and children
  • psychological and educational evaluations for learning problems and ADHD/ADD (all ages)
  • hypnotherapy, hypnosis training and consultation for mental health professionals. (New groups forming.)

The Pan-Massachusetts Challenge. August 4th - 5th, 2007: 4,969 cyclists, 2 days, 192 miles from Sturbridge to Provincetown. Last year (the PMC's 28th year) we raised $33 million for cancer research and treatment! The 2007 PMC was my 4th, joining other cyclists to raise money for the internationally renowned Dana Farber Cancer Institute in Boston.  This year, August 2nd - 3rd, will be my 5th.
